📚 What is Computer Network Simulation?

Computer network simulation is like creating a virtual playground where we can build and test computer networks without using real hardware. Instead of using physical computers, cables, and routers, we use software to imitate how these things behave. This allows us to experiment, make changes, and see what happens in a safe and controlled environment. It's a bit like playing with LEGOs, but instead of building castles, we are building digital networks!

✨ Key Principles Behind Simulation

  • 🌐 Modeling: The first step is to create a model of the network. This means deciding what components to include (like computers, servers, and routers) and how they are connected. It’s like drawing a map of your network.
  • 🚦 Traffic Generation: Next, we need to simulate the traffic that flows through the network. This includes data packets being sent from one computer to another. We can use different patterns to represent different types of network use, such as web browsing or video streaming.
  • ⚙️ Simulation Engine: This is the heart of the simulator. It uses mathematical equations and algorithms to determine how the network will behave based on the model and traffic. For example, it calculates how long it takes for data to travel from one point to another.
  • 📊 Analysis: Finally, we analyze the results of the simulation. This involves looking at things like network speed, reliability, and efficiency. We can use this information to make improvements to the network design.

🌍 Real-World Examples

  • 🎮 Video Games: Game developers use network simulation to test how online multiplayer games will perform with lots of players. This helps them make sure the game is smooth and doesn't lag.
  • 🏢 Business Networks: Companies use simulations to design their office networks. They can figure out how many computers and servers they need and how to connect them to ensure everyone can access the internet and share files quickly.
  • 📡 Mobile Networks: Engineers use simulations to plan cell phone networks. They can determine where to put cell towers and how to configure them to provide good coverage to everyone.
  • 🚑 Emergency Services: Emergency services can use simulations to optimize their communication networks so that they can respond quickly and effectively during emergencies.
  • 🛰️ Satellite Communications: Scientists use network simulation to plan satellite communication systems. This is important for connecting remote areas to the internet and for conducting research in space.
